721501541 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 721501542. Its totient is φ = 721501540.
The previous prime is 721501523. The next prime is 721501577. The reversal of 721501541 is 145105127.
It is a weak prime.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 614296225 + 107205316 = 24785^2 + 10354^2 .
It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(145105127) is a distict pr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 721501541 - 210 = 721500517 is a prime.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 721501541.
It is a congruent number.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(721501511)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 360750770 + 360750771.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(360750771).
Almost surely, 2721501541 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
721501541 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
721501541 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
721501541 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1400, while the sum is 26.
The square root of 721501541 is about 26860.7807220862. The cubic root of 721501541 is about 896.9035734457.
Adding to 721501541 its reverse (145105127), we get a palindrome (866606668).
